Tilting roadway is used for pressing and prevents falling joint support
Technical Field
The invention relates to a pressing anti-falling bracket, in particular to a pressing anti-falling combined bracket for an inclined roadway.
Background
At present, inclined roadways are often adopted as main service roadways in the coal mining process, such as an upper mountain, a lower mountain, an air return inclined roadway, a transportation inclined roadway and the like, if a cross-mining working surface is encountered, when the roadway is close to the working surface on the upper part of a top plate, an anchor net rope combined support cannot be adopted, at the moment, the roadway support is usually supported in a passive support mode (i-steel support, pi-steel support, U-steel support and the like) or the inclined roadway under complex stress condition is encountered, a frame is required to be adopted for reinforcing the inclined roadway, and as the roadway has a certain inclination angle, the problem that how to fix the support to the direction of the top plate and the bottom plate of the inclined roadway is solved, in addition, after the inclined roadway is pressed, the support is inclined, the support structure is invalid, and accidents are caused.

Detailed Description
When the support is installed in the inclined roadway, the support connecting plate installation angle is adjusted through the top plate tray rotating bearing, the upper support pull rod, the bottom plate tray rotating bearing, the lower support pull rod and the lower support rotating bearing, the support connecting plate is fixed on a roadway top plate rock stratum through the upper support pull rod and the support leg upper support fixing device, the support connecting plate is fixed on the roadway bottom plate rock stratum through the lower support pull rod and the support leg lower support fixing device, so that the fixed installation of the support perpendicular to the inclined roadway top bottom plate is realized, and after the roadway is pressed, the support is provided with an effective supporting structure through the top plate fixing device.
